The Center for Violence-Free Relationships offers a wide range of crisis and stabilizing services for women, men, teens, and children who are survivors of domestic violence and sexual assault. Our services are provided by certified case managers who specialize in helping survivors of domestic violence and sexual assault through their healing process.
We solve short-term crises and facilitate the healing process for long-term empowerment.
The Center’s services include:
24-Hour Support and Information Line
Confidential Safe House program
Individual Peer Counseling & Case Management Services
Domestic Violence and Sexual Assault Support Groups
Sexual Assault Response Team
Legal Services
Latina Outreach Advocate
Underserved Populations
Friends and Family Services
Prevention and Education
